443 Commits (5093920d5cb81643ec91cb6b9b031e88879e595b)

Author SHA1 Message Date
Mathias Bynens faecae0ba7
Match CommonMark spec exactly 7 years ago
Mathias Bynens d9cb3ccb67
Don’t recognize U+2028 as a newline character 7 years ago
Alex Kocharin a1c93811f8 Fix incorrect level recalculation in text_collapse 7 years ago
Alex Kocharin d08c7c3897 Add an example related to case-insensitive comparisons 7 years ago
Vitaly Puzrin c36309ef1c Bump eslint & update CS 7 years ago
Alex Kocharin fa7a419161 Fix edge case for list indents 7 years ago
Alex Kocharin 7421ecce67 Improve normalization for reference label matching 7 years ago
Alex Kocharin e519e6ac19 Fix emphasis matching where delimiters are multiple of 3 7 years ago
Alex Kocharin 02a2605e84 Reduce maximum length for numeric html entities 7 years ago
Alex Kocharin 7997fdadcd Apply special rules for collapsing whitespace inside code blocks 7 years ago
Alex Kocharin 254b776beb Allow tildes in info string of a fence block with tilde marker 7 years ago
Alex Kocharin f872cbc31e Allow spaces inside brackets in links 7 years ago
Ted Ge d533c27017 fix normalize function name (#538) 7 years ago
Michal Grňo 6847c9481f
It's "typographic", not "typographyc" 8 years ago
jjyyxx 7f99cfa9b4
fix typo 8 years ago
Alex Kocharin 04d36a3f1a Fix smartquotes around softbreaks 8 years ago
Cyril Auburtin 3e048188c0
typo 8 years ago
Alex Kocharin 2959f8c27c Update CommonMark spec to 0.28 9 years ago
Alex Kocharin a733ffa8b6 Fix blockquote termination inside lists 9 years ago
Rifat Nabi 696231b28d Fix a small typo 9 years ago
Zanin Andrea b7dd15fa9c typo correction 9 years ago
Ullallulloo bf4ba21254 Fixed typos in comment 9 years ago
Alex Kocharin c57f593b23 Fix blockquote termination by list item 9 years ago
Vitaly Puzrin c9199b582d Better error message for bad input type, close #324 9 years ago
Alex Kocharin f0e7e562ea Fix blockquote termination inside indented lists 9 years ago
Alex Kocharin dc1c392a4d Remove tabs at the beginning of the line in paragraphs 9 years ago
Alex Kocharin d29f421927 Fix table indentation issues 9 years ago
Vitaly Puzrin 09e9ad1688 Add missed h2..h6 to whitelisted block tags 9 years ago
Alex Kocharin 9eb2a26005 Fix backtick handling inside tables 9 years ago
Alex Kocharin 93544ee4bf Fenced code block info string should not contain fence marker 9 years ago
Igor Bochkariov ebc9f50759 fallback to reference if a link is not valid 9 years ago
Alex Kocharin f5a06ec0b6 Make link/image/reference helpers overridable 10 years ago
Alex Kocharin 1bb254b879 Allow tabs inside GFM tables 10 years ago
Alex Kocharin 7a053ef4c5 Fix tab behavior inside blockquotes 10 years ago
Alex Kocharin 18dd8e3a71 Fix list terminating paragraph shenanigans 10 years ago
Alex Kocharin 1ecf143db0 Fix lists and headings 10 years ago
Alex Kocharin f07d3862ff Implement odd matching rules for emphasis 10 years ago
Alex Kocharin e5696e5b36 Partially fix tabs inside code blocks 10 years ago
Alex Kocharin 9335394a99 Disable replacements inside autolinks 10 years ago
arve0 e9306a572c fence renderer: fix concat of class array 10 years ago
arve0 4c4b66bd57 code renderer: do not render double space before attrs 10 years ago
Vitaly Puzrin 5cd9007edf Render `code_inline` & `code_block` attributes if exist, #261 10 years ago
Vitaly Puzrin b7c868b64b Renderer: token stream should stay immutable, close #260 10 years ago
Alex Kocharin 6dbe532460 Replace standalone CR with LF when normalizing newlines 10 years ago
Marijn Haverbeke 5837f6bc5b Add an attrGet method to Token 10 years ago
Christopher Breeden a2b7b8e156 Fixes #246, HTML Escaping alt-tag twice. 10 years ago
Vitaly Puzrin 760050edcb eslint update & code cleanup 10 years ago
Sean Lang 86eea8c1d3 fix misspelling of "parser" 10 years ago
Sean Lang 10d6448b22 support tables with missing values 10 years ago
Alex Kocharin 53aec24168 Improve performance in `skipToken` when maxNesting is exceeded 10 years ago